Precision measurement of the K. alpha. transitions in heliumlike Ge sup 30+

A measurement of the 1{ital s}2{ital p} {sup 1}{ital P}{sub 1}{r arrow}1{ital s}{sup 2} {ital S}{sub 0} resonance transition in heliumlike germanium (Ge{sup 30+}) has been made on the Lawrence Livermore National Laboratory electron-beam ion trap to a precision of 21 ppm. The result is compared with theoretical values and confirms a trend previously seen in the differences between experiment and theory for this transition as a function of {ital Z}. Results for the 1{ital s}2{ital p} {sup 3}{ital P}{sub 1}{r arrow}1{ital s}{sup 2} {ital S}{sub 0} and 1{ital s}2{ital p} {sup 3}{ital P}{sub 2}{r arrow}1{ital s}{sup 2} {ital S}{sub 0} intercombination lines and for the 1{ital s}2{ital s} {sup 3}{ital S}{sub 1}{r arrow}1{ital s}{sup 2} {sup 1}{ital S}{sub 0} forbidden line are also presented and show similar differences with theoretical predictions.
